add 'test' and 'scan-ips' subcommands
test: one-shot end-to-end probe. Issues a GET to api.ipify.org through the configured relay and prints status + body + timing. Clear pass/fail with specific diagnostics for 502/504 (auth_key mismatch, quota, etc). Verified live: 3.8s round-trip returning the caller's real IP. scan-ips: parallel TLS probe of 28 known Google frontend IPs with SNI=front_domain. Reports which are reachable and sorts by latency. Users pick the fastest and paste into google_ip. Verified live: 7/28 reachable (the others were Windscribe'd out), top 3 ranked. Both subcommands share the existing config.json and require no extra flags. Default 'mhrv-rs' with no subcommand runs the proxy as before.
